I applied through the school's co-op site and was scheduled for an interview a few days after the posting closed.
The interview was 45-60 minutes and was conducted with three people over the phone. Most of the interview involved going over the technical skills listed on my resume. A short programming exercise was also given.

The interview was relaxed and was very similar to interviews from other companies requiring similar skills.
Note that the interview was for a large number of software development positions and was catered to the applicant's interests. In my case, it was low-level programming.
Programming Exercise: Bit Manipulations.
